At a glance
| Dimension | Psychiatrists | Clinical Nurse Specialists |
|---|---|---|
| Median pay | — | $93,600 |
| Employment | 24,800 | 3,282,010 |
| Employment outlook (2024–34) · BLS projection | About average (+6.1%) | About average (+4.9%) |
| Annual openings · BLS projection | 900 | 189,100 |
| Typical education · O*NET | Most of these occupations require graduate school. For example, they may require a master's degree, and some require a Ph.D., M.D., or J.D. (law degree). | Most of these occupations require graduate school. For example, they may require a master's degree, and some require a Ph.D., M.D., or J.D. (law degree). |
| AI exposure · published exposure studies | Moderate · 57th pct | Moderate · 39th pct |
| Global GenAI gradient · ILO ISCO-08 · via crosswalk | — | 47th pct · 25% of tasks |
| Observed AI use · Anthropic Economic Index | — | Augmentation-leaning (55.2%) |
| Mostly remote-capable · Dingel–Neiman | — | No |
Pay and employment are BLS OEWS estimates; outlook and openings are BLS 2024–2034 projections; AI exposure and observed-use figures come from separate research and reflect exposure and usage, not predictions that either job will disappear. Compare like with like.
Skills
Shared: Therapy and Counseling, Psychology, Medicine and Dentistry, Active Listening, Social Perceptiveness, Oral Comprehension, Oral Expression, English Language, Speaking, Critical Thinking, Written Comprehension, Reading Comprehension, Writing, Judgment and Decision Making, Written Expression, Deductive Reasoning, Inductive Reasoning, Active Learning, Monitoring, Problem Sensitivity, Speech Recognition, Speech Clarity, Coordination, Service Orientation, Complex Problem Solving, Category Flexibility, Biology, Learning Strategies, Information Ordering, Education and Training, Customer and Personal Service, Sociology and Anthropology, Persuasion, Instructing, Near Vision.
Specific to Psychiatrists
- Science
- Fluency of Ideas
- Negotiation
- Operations Analysis
- Systems Analysis
Specific to Clinical Nurse Specialists
- Time Management
- Administration and Management
- Selective Attention
- Systems Evaluation
- Management of Personnel Resources
Knowledge, skills & abilities O*NET rates as important for each occupation. “Shared” are common to both; the columns list what is distinctive to each (top by the order O*NET surfaces).
